I'm looking at getting a russian tortoise and people only say you need a 8'x4' minimum but I was wondering if I could make a 6'x6' table. I guess what I'm asking is if it better for it to be longer or is it just a certain amount of area it needs?
Square footage is the key.
Not so much the shape.
Russian tortoises walk around a lot...And they are skilled climbers.
Make it as large as you are able to.
Tweak it as needed.
